Output 39c50e106a8b4e59d80689fbdbfcfa8bb7fa2de61971f4a3b51304a73ccdf07e:1

value
35416546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00c7bea50534fa27290e9adbcf3dff8da1d086ee OP_EQUAL
address
M7yHWwDiy4pg2uBLpiaUBmaMVXobJrLmiz
transaction
39c50e106a8b4e59d80689fbdbfcfa8bb7fa2de61971f4a3b51304a73ccdf07e
spent
true